Mark Murphy, President and CEO of the Green Bay Packers on Becoming a Great Leader

On this episode of #ThePlaybook, Mark Murphy, President and CEO of the Green Bay Packers, sits down to discuss: [1:22] - What it means to be the CEO of the only publicly owned franchise in the NFL [8:06] - How their Titletown development has evolved to include the TitletownTech venture studio and fund [11:46] - What makes the Green Bay Packers fan base so loyal [14:15] - His thoughts on how to take your ego out of the equation as a leader Tweet me your takeaway from today’s episode @davidme...

Deb Liu, CEO and President of Ancestry, on The Key to Success

On this episode of #ThePlaybook, Deb Liu, CEO and President of Ancestry and author of Take Back Your Power, [1:48] - How her own childhood experience showed her the need to empower women in the workplace [4:06] - The best way to ask your superiors for what you want and make your ambitions known [12:40] - How to overcome the idea that success is possible without the help of others [16:10] - Why asking for actionable feedback is an essential part of growing as a leader
